Haven't hread from Thom yet but in looking through the SA's it appears that Dire is Inspires evil twin. When reading Beheading Causes Dire to enemy's in Command Distance and Inspires friendly within same. Both have ratings 1-5 and Dire clearly say Morale Test, maybe under Inspiration it was just omitted. I also noted under Dissention it states "any roll that involes LD" so shouldn't it say the same under Inspiration if it is to cover all LD test.

With itself...


I think it is not, but the questions is there:



page 75:

"Leaders with this ability may add their level of inspiration to the effective LD value for both themselves and friendly models within their command radius"

What leads me to the next wuestion regarding the inspiration....

Whether it is usable for all LD tests or not ....is it cumulative?

Letīs say a Mounted Hussar Bannerman and Max Steiner...... or two Bannermen?
